Na FreeHostingu Endora běží desítky tisíc webů. Přidejte se ještě dnes!
Vytvořit web zdarmaNa FreeHostingu Endora běží desítky tisíc webů. Přidejte se ještě dnes!
Vytvořit web zdarma30.1.2013 Snaha o vyuit pamt FlashROM v PC jako alternativy k pevnmu disku sah a nkam do potku 90-tch let minulho stolet. V roce 1991 pedstavila firma SanDisk svj prvn flashdisk v podob PCMCIA karty o kapacit 20 MB uren zejmna pro penosn potae. V prmyslovch PC se zase prosadily moduly DiskOnChip a pamov karty CompactFlash, kter jsou kompatabiln s rozhranm IDE (ty novj podporuj i rychl penosy UDMA). Po roce 2003 se zaaly objevovat 3,5" a 2,5" flashdisky s rozhranm SCSI a IDE, avak cena za 1 MB oproti bnm pevnm diskm byla dov vy a rychlost zpisu nijak zvratn. Dky neustlmu pokroku ve vvoji technologi flash pamt a rstu objemu vroby dolo ped pr lety k podstatnmu zlevnn, naven kapacity a vychytn dtskch nemoc, take se konen flashdisky staly plnohodnotnou alternativou k HDD, kter zejmna rychlost a ni spotebou u pekonaly. Pro notebooky nabz navc SSD velkou vhodu mechanick odolnosti a tm vt bezpenost dat a mobilitu, i kdy je teba pamatovat na to, e i u sebelep znaky me nastat nhl smrt a SSD se bez varovn odporou se vemi daty. Proto nezbv ne zlohovat, zlohovat, zlohovat. Dnes jsou k dispozici i modely SSD v podob Express Card, mSATA nebo PCI-E karet a velikosti 1,8". Vce o historii SSD zde a zde.
J jsem s koup SSD dost dlouho vhal, protoe jsem si byl dobe vdom ady problm SSD, zejmna omezenho potu zpis (kad flash pam se tm ni, protoe pi mazacm cyklu degraduje oxidov vrstva izolujc plovouc hradlo), pomalej rychlosti pi zpisu (zejmna malch blok) a tak kvli cen. Problm s ivotnost flash pamt e neustle chytej algoritmy Wear Levelingu implementovan v adii a firmware SSD (snaha o eliminaci rozdlnho opoteben pamovch buek pi zpisu). Je vak paradoxn, e novj technologie (jemnj litografie) flash pamt dosahuj neustle ni ivotnosti buek.
technologie NAND Flash poet mazacch cykl SLC (Single-Level Cell) 100000 MLC (Multi-Level Cell) > 25 nm 10000 MLC (Multi-Level Cell) 20 - 25 nm 5000 MLC (Multi-Level Cell) < 20 nm 3000 TLC (Multi-Level Cell) < 20 nm 1000 - 3000 QLC (Quad-Level Cell) < 20 nm < 1000
Je to prost dsledek tlaku na cenu. Vrobci pamt vymysleli jednoduch trik, jak snadno znsobit kapacitu pi minimlnm zven sloitosti a velikosti ipu. U MLC pamt se ulo do jedn pamov buky n jeden, ale vce bit informace. Prakticky se nzev MLC vil pro 2-bitov buky i kdy Multi me znamenat cokoliv > 1. Toho je dosaeno tm, e se plovouc hradlo me pi zpisu vybt jen sten a nst tak 4 rzn rovn nboje (2 mezn a 2 mezistavy). tec obvod pak mus umt tyto tyi rovn od sebe odliit. Podobn tak u TLC pamt nese 1 buka 3 bity informace v 8 rovnch nboje a u se objevuj i prvn QLC pamti s 4 bity v 1 buce (16 rovn nboje). Asi nemusm dle zmiovat, e m vce je nutn tchto rovn rozliit, tm vce je ten nchyln na chyby (m-li plovouc hradlo vlivem degradace svod a postupn se vybj, snadnji se zmn hodnota nboje mezi 2 sousednmi rovnmi, ne by tomu bylo pi rozliovn pouhch dvou stav nabito / vybito). Dnes jsou nejvce prodvan SSD s MLC pamtmi, kter nabz velk kapacity za slun ceny, zatm co SSD s SLC jsou k dispozici v kapacitch nkolik mlo destek GB a jsou podstatn dra.
Pi vbru SSD jsem proetl spoustu recenz a vybral nkolik kandidt. Velk draz jsem kladl na spolehlivost, kde vm zejmna firm intel, kter m s vrobou SSD mnohalet zkuenosti a t se dobrmu jmnu. Pesvdil m t Samsung, kter m pod palcem kompletn vrobu svch SSD od pamovch ip pes adi po firmware a dodv sv SSD pro velk firmy jako Dell i Apple. Take jsem se nakonec omezil na tyto dva vrobce, tak proto e jako jedin nabz ke svm SSD software pro manuln TRIM, co se hod pro star OS jak Windows 7 s nativn podporou nebo pokud adi nepracuje v reimu AHCI.
- Intel 320 - u star ada SSD s vlastnm adiem intel a 25nm NAND MLC Flash, zruka 5 let, pomrn vysok cena, rychlost spe nis (burst), ale zas u malch blok lep ne novej ada 520. Dky del dob na trhu snad odladn FW od dtskch nemoc. Cena 4394 K za 120GB model, v souasnosti u asi nen dostupn.
- Intel 520 - nov ada SSD kontroverznm radiem SandForce a 25nm NAND MLC Flash, zruka 5 let. Intel sice napsal vlastn firmware, kter eliminuje vtinu bug, ale zejm n vechny (nap. problm pi pouit AES 256 ifrovn). Vkonov je rychlej v burstu, zejmna dky realtime kompresi, ale ve 4 kB blocch m slab vkon ne pedchdce ady 320. Dky pouit kompresi dochz k zajmavmu efektu, e kdy te teba HD Tune przdn sektory, tak to lta >500MB/s, zatmco u obsazench sektor to skokove klesne na 250MB/s. Cena je ni ne u ady 320, 120GB verze za slunch 3124 K. UPDATE: Bohuel nhl smrt se nevyhb ani SSD intelu a zchrana dat po kompresi a ifrovn bv velmi obtn, by n pln nemon, jak tvrd firma ACE Data Recovery. Za zmnku stoj, e jeden z dvod selhn tchto SSD je chyba ve FW, pi kter dojde k havrii v ppad, e uivatel zapisuje pili mnoho nekomprimovatelnch dat, kter FW pet a dostane se tak do krizovho stavu, z kterho se u nevzpamatuje. To se me stt mnohem dve, ne fyzicky odejdou njak buky v NAND Flash chipech.
- Intel DC S3700 - nov SSD s vlastnm adiem a 25nm NAND MLC Flash. Velmi rychl, uren spe pro servery. Tomu tak odpovd vy cena 5786 K za 100GB model. zruka 3 roky.
- Samsung 830 star typ ale pesto vkonov dost nahoe, pouv vlastn adi a 27nm NAND MLC Flash, zruka jen 3 roky. Cena o neco ni nez intel, 128MB model kolem 3000 K, ale v souasnosti se u neprodv.
- Samsung 840 Pro (nePro verze obsahuje TLC pamti!). 21nm NAND MLC Flash, Vkon je o nco lep jak u ady 830, cena o nco vy, 128GB model za 3245 K zruka 5 let. http://www.samsung.com/us/computer/memory-storage/MZ-7PD128BW
Problm s retenc dat na starm SSD Crucial v4 32 GB
30.12.2025 Ped lety jsem dostal od jednoho kamarda na hran star SSD Crucial v4 32 GB s tm, e u je njak mrtv/neiteln. BIOS ho jet normln detekoval, ale filesystm byl u rozmrdan. Tehd se mi ho povedlo "opravit" aktualizac firmware z verze S5FAMM22 na S5FAMM25, pi kter zrove dolo k vmazu dat. SSD se pak tvil zdrav, rychlost ten a zpisu byla odpovdajc a konzistentn. SSD jsem obas pouval na njak pokusn instalace OS na PC s ktermi jsem si hrl.
Te jsem po cca 2 letech vythl SSD ze skn, kde leel celou dobu odpojen od napjen, protoe jsem se chtl podvat na njak data z posledn proveden instalace. Disk se zdl na prvn pohled iteln, ale pi pokusu o koprovn soubor jsem zhy dostal CRC error. A to u mnoha soubor. Spustil sem tedy Error Scan v HD Tune a povrch disku ze zaal barvit pkn do ruda. Celkem bylo reportovno 497 neitelnch sektor. Zajmav bylo, e po vce sputnch Error Scanu nejprve dochzelo k poklesu neitelnch sektor a nkam na 350 (e by se FW snail nco opravovat?), ale pak zas poet skokov vzrostl a u jen nhodn kolsal. A po cca 10 h pipojench na napjen jsem nebyl schopen pest soubor, kter m zajmal. Tak bylo zajmav, e chyby ten se vdy objevovaly jen v prvn polovin disku, co ale pi pouit Wear Leveling algoritmu nedv logiku. Nicmn jsem zkusil vytvoit oddl lec jen na druh polovin disku, avak pi jeho formtovn se hned zaaly objevovat chyby, take ty pouze nebyly tecm testem detekovan, ale v prdeli byl cel disk. Zkusil jsem ho taky dt do mrazku, ale dn pozitivn efekt to nemlo. Asi by to znovu na chvli vyeil low-level format (ATA secure erase), ale co pak s takovm sklerotickm diskem...
Tak jsem ho aspo rozebral. Uvnit se nachz PCB s adiem Phison PS3105-S5-1 v BGA pouzdru, 4 MLC 25nm NAND Flash Micron 29F64G08CBAAB osazen na 4 pozicch z 16 a jedna pam Micron s marking kdem D9LQX, co je MT46H32M32LFB5-6 (LPDDR SDRAM 128 MB, 166 MHz). Zajmav vypadaj ploky pro ladic konektor J2, kde je evidentn vyveden JTAG a UART. Ale stejn nemm dn vhodn nhradn NAND Flash ipy na vmnu, take nakonec letl do koe. Je to praktick ukzka toho, e problm s retenc dat u odpojench SSD (i jinch Flash pamt) existuje a vrobci SSD tyto daje moc neprezentuj. V datasheetu od Micronu se meme akort dost, e retence dat m bt 10 let a vdr bunk 5000 pepis, ale dn podrobnj podmnky, za kterch to plat. Celkem logicky lze oekvat, e m vcekrt je buka pepsan, tm vce je zdegradovan izolan vrstva gate jejho MOSFETu a tm rychleji bude nboj leakovat pry, jak zhruba naznauje obrzek na str. 6 tto prezentace. Bohuel si to dnes ada lid neuvdomuje a zapomnaj na to, e klasick rotan disky maj stle sv vhody...
Crucial SSD v4 PCB top PCB bottom error scan Flash endurance